
【Android 多线程编程】
文章平均质量分 73
YongHui_Luo
Android、React Native 、JavaScript
展开
-
Android UI线程和非UI线程
UI线程及Android的单线程模型原则 当应用启动,系统会创建一个主线程(main thread)。 这个主线程负责向UI组件分发事件(包括绘制事件),也是在这个主线程里,你的应用和Android的UI组件(components from the Android UI toolkit (components from the android.widget and androi转载 2014-07-16 11:26:22 · 545 阅读 · 0 评论 -
android的PowerManager和PowerManager.WakeLock
android的PowerManager和PowerManager.WakeLock前言 学习android一段时间了,为了进一步了解android的应用是如何设计开发的,决定详细研究几个开源的android应用。从一些开源应用中吸收点东西,一边进行量的积累,一边探索android的学习研究方向。这里我首先选择了jwood的 Standup Timer 项目。本文将把转载 2014-12-12 17:33:51 · 559 阅读 · 0 评论 -
Executors
一、 初始化的几种方式 1、Executors.newCachedThreadPool() CacheThreadPool : 将为每一个任务创建一个线程(程序执行的过程中通常会创建与所需数量相同的线程),然后在回收旧线程时,停止创建新线程,因此它是合理的Executors首选。 2、 Execut原创 2015-11-18 17:59:18 · 1778 阅读 · 1 评论 -
String、StringBuffer和StringBuilder的区别
对String、StringBuffer、StringBuilder进行区分,根据三者的区别,探索合适的使用时机。原创 2016-03-15 16:56:16 · 603 阅读 · 0 评论 -
Android线程优先级
转自http://www.cnblogs.com/GnagWang/archive/2011/03/24/1993571.htmlProcess.setThreadPriority(Process.THREAD_PRIORITY_BACKGROUND); //设置线程优先级为后台,这样当多个线程并发后很多无关紧要的线程分配的CPU时间将会减少,有利于主线程的处理,有以下几种:转载 2016-05-15 23:30:42 · 794 阅读 · 0 评论